A lot less paint and a lot more pressure when turning the ring gear. As it sits, it is deep. Try taking out 5 thou and see what happens. Take a pic of the pinion as it sits in the housing. It will have the opposite pattern...i.e. if it looks shallow, then it's deep.

The setup I'm using is exactly like the image below. Starting from the inner side:

- Stock inner oil slinger
- Replacement Inner Timken Bearing
- Replacement Inner Timken Race
- Replacement Omix Oil baffle
- Preload shims (set at .0064)
- Replacement Outer Timken Race
- Replacement Outer Timken Bearing
- Stock outer oil slinger
- New Spicer pinion seal
- Stock yoke, using the stock washer and pinion nut (top is ground for repeated installation and removal)

In terms of what I adjusted, I was referring to the pinion preload shims. Those are now at .064. The only shims on the Eaton E Locker carrier side is .010 on the non ring gear bearing side. There are no shims on the ring gear bearing side. Since I'm on the tight side of .005 backlash, I believe I could remove .001 to .002 on the pinion preload shims, which should help put me little better on backlash and pattern.
